Daggett County approves time-sensitive UDOT Federal Aid agreement to be ratified next week
Summary
The commission approved a time-sensitive Federal Aid Agreement with UDOT and agreed to ratify the agreement at next week’s meeting, after Commissioner Matt Tippets raised urgency and Commissioner Randy Asay moved approval.

Commissioner Matt Tippets asked the commission to address a time-sensitive Utah Department of Transportation (UDOT) Federal Aid Agreement and said it needed immediate attention. Commissioner Randy Asay moved to "approve the UDOT Federal Aid Agreement and ratify it next week," a motion seconded by Commissioner Matt Tippets that carried with Commissioner Jack Lytle recorded as absent.
The commission treated the agreement as time sensitive and scheduled formal ratification for the next meeting. No fiscal amount or contract number is specified in the minutes; the motion was recorded as an authorization to approve the agreement now and ratify it next week.
